By replacing a traditional system that uses two ride height sensors (on the front and rear axles), you can achieve potential cost savings of up to 20€ per vehicle—taking into account the costs of sensors, wiring harnesses, and assembly.

According to the UN Regulation No. 48, Revision 9 (UNR48-09), Manual Headlight Leveling systems must be phased out in new vehicles starting from 2027, in favor of automatic solutions.

COMPREDICT’s solution estimates vehicle’s pitch angle to adjust the vehicle’s headlight beam in two primary scenarios:

  1. Static adjustment: By detecting every change in vehicle load, including those specified by regulatory requirements.
  2. Dynamic adjustment: By adapting the headlight beam to real-time driving conditions such as braking, acceleration, or road inclines.

COMPREDICT’s Virtual Sensor uses existing vehicle data, such as wheel speed or accelerations signals. This makes it easy to integrate without additional hardware, ensuring fast deployment across various motor designs. Sufficient data quality and CAN data access in your vehicles are required.
